Author: vinay.sajip
Date: Tue Jan 20 23:49:13 2009
New Revision: 68827
Log:
Issue 5013: Fixed bug in FileHandler when delay was set.

@@ -785,10 +784,12 @@
self.mode = mode
self.encoding = encoding
if delay:
+ #We don't open the stream, but we still need to call the
+ #Handler constructor to set level, formatter, lock etc.
+ Handler.__init__(self)
self.stream = None
else:
- stream = self._open()
- StreamHandler.__init__(self, stream)
+ StreamHandler.__init__(self, self._open())
def close(self):
"""
@@ -820,8 +821,7 @@
constructor, open it before calling the superclass's emit.
"""
if self.stream is None:
- stream = self._open()
- StreamHandler.__init__(self, stream)
+ self.stream = self._open()
StreamHandler.emit(self, record)
